Apple generally supports their Mac products with software updates for 7 years?

iOS support has changed a lot over the years. 2007 iPhone was only supported for 3 total years to iPhone os 3.xxxx. Same with the iPhone 3g (3 total years)

iPhone 3GS was supported 4 years.

iPhone 4 4 years.

iPhone 4s was supported 5 years. Fall 2011 to fall 2016

iPhone 5/5c was supported 5 years ago fall 2012-fall 2017

iPhone 5S (a7 first 64 bit Apple mobile processor) fall 2013- fall 2019?? I suspect iPhone 5s end of life support for sure. That’s 6 years of software support from release date.

iPhone 6 A8. I suspect will last one more year.

So 6 years mobile processor support now. Almost the same as their desktop/laptop support.
